Video Subtitling Software | Download Free on PC or Mac
SponsoredAdd custom subtitles to videos with subtitling tools. Import subtitles or create your own. Vi…4.5/5 (1,409 reviews)
Add Subtitles To Any Video | Add Text to Video Fast
SponsoredAdd subtitles to your videos instantly with Descript. Make your videos accessible with sma…4/5 (161 reviews)

Feedback